Chip: E31

Vendor: SIFIVE
Family: Essential
Main Core: E31
RECOMMENDED CONFIGURATIONS

Find the Ideal Tool Configuration for E31

Throughout our recommended debug and trace solutions, you can easily find and select the most suitable tool configuration for your chip. Whether you need to perform simple hardware debugging or more advanced tasks such as off-chip tracing, the following TRACE32 configurations will provide you with a good starting point.

Debug Solution for 32-bit RISC-V
Hardware Lauterbach µTrace for RV32 with MIPI20-HS whisker
Software Includes PowerView software, debug license and 1 year maintenance
PC connection USB 3
Debug port 1 (MIPI20T, MIPI10, IDC20A)
Supported Chips All 32-bit RISC-V chips
Multicore debugging Among RV32 cores via optional license
On-chip trace planned
Off-chip trace Hardware is ready for upcoming trace standard
Signal probing via optional Mixed-Signal Probe
Universal Debugger with Ethernet/USB and System Trace support
Hardware Lauterbach PowerDebug X50 with CombiProbe 2
Software Includes PowerView software, debug license and 1 year maintenance
PC connection USB 3 and Gigabit Ethernet
Debug & Trace port 1 by default, 2 with extra whisker
Multicore debugging Yes, for same and other architectures via optional licenses
On-chip trace via optional license
Off-chip trace 4 bit parallel trace ports (for e.g. STP/STM) on each port
Recording speed 400 Mbit/s per signal (3.2 Gbit/s total)
Streaming 140 Mbyte/s
Trace Memory 512 MByte
Signal probing via optional Mixed-Signal Probe
Essential Debugger with USB and System Trace support
Hardware Lauterbach PowerDebug E40 with CombiProbe 2
Software Includes PowerView software, debug license and 1 year maintenance
PC connection USB 3
Debug & Trace port 1 by default, 2 with extra whisker
Multicore debugging Yes, for same and other architectures via optional licenses
On-chip trace via optional license
Off-chip trace 4 bit parallel trace ports (for e.g. STP/STM) on each port
Recording speed 400 Mbit/s per signal (3.2 Gbit/s total)
Streaming 140 Mbyte/s
Trace Memory 512 MByte
Signal probing via optional Mixed-Signal Probe
Essential Debugger with USB
Hardware Lauterbach PowerDebug E40 with IDC20A debug probe
Software Includes PowerView software, debug license and 1 year maintenance
PC connection USB 3
Debug port 1 (IDC20A)
Debug clock 10 kHz to 100 MHz (depends on target)
Voltage range 0.4 V to 5.0 V
Multicore debugging Yes, for same and other architectures via optional licenses
On-chip trace via optional license
Off-chip trace via optional CombiProbe extension (for 4 bit trace ports)
Universal Debugger ready for PowerTrace
Hardware Lauterbach PowerDebug X50 with IDC20A debug probe
Software Includes PowerView software, debug license and 1 year maintenance
PC connection USB 3 and Gigabit Ethernet
Debug port 1 (IDC20A)
Debug clock 10 kHz to 100 MHz (depends on target)
Voltage range 0.4 V to 5.0 V
Multicore debugging Yes, for same and other architectures via optional licenses
On-chip trace via optional license
Off-chip trace via optional PowerTrace or CombiProbe extension
Universal Debugger ready for PowerTrace
Hardware Lauterbach PowerDebug X50 with IDC20A debug probe
Software Includes PowerView software, debug license and 1 year maintenance
PC connection USB 3 and Gigabit Ethernet
Debug port 1 (IDC20A)
Debug clock 10 kHz to 100 MHz (depends on target)
Voltage range 0.4 V to 5.0 V
Multicore debugging Yes, for same and other architectures via optional licenses
On-chip trace via optional license
Off-chip trace via optional PowerTrace or CombiProbe extension
Essential Debugger with USB
Hardware Lauterbach PowerDebug E40 with IDC20A debug probe
Software Includes PowerView software, debug license and 1 year maintenance
PC connection USB 3
Debug port 1 (IDC20A)
Debug clock 10 kHz to 100 MHz (depends on target)
Voltage range 0.4 V to 5.0 V
Multicore debugging Yes, for same and other architectures via optional licenses
On-chip trace via optional license
Off-chip trace via optional CombiProbe extension (for 4 bit trace ports)
High-performance Parallel Trace
Debug Hardware Lauterbach PowerDebug X50 with debug probe
Trace Hardware PowerTrace III with AutoFocus II trace probe
Software Includes PowerView software, debug license and 1 year maintenance
Multicore support Yes, for same and other architectures via optional licenses
PC connection USB 3 and Gigabit Ethernet
Debug Port 1
Trace Port 2x MICTOR38 connectors for one port with up to 36 signals
Recording speed 600+ Mbit/s per signal for 17 signal
Streaming 400 Mbyte/s
Trace Memory 8 GByte
Signal probing via optional Mixed-Signal Probe
Cost-Effective Parallel Trace
Debug Hardware Lauterbach PowerDebug X50 with debug probe
Trace Hardware PowerTrace II Lite with AutoFocus II trace probe
Software Includes PowerView software, debug license and 1 year maintenance
Multicore support Yes, for same and other architectures via optional licenses
PC connection USB 3 and Gigabit Ethernet
Debug Port 1
Trace Port 2x MICTOR38 connectors for one port with up to 36 signals
Recording speed 450 Mbit/s per signal for 17 signal
Streaming 100 Mbyte/s
Trace Memory 1 GByte
Signal probing not available
High-performance Serial Trace
Debug Hardware Lauterbach PowerDebug X50 with debug probe
Trace Hardware PowerTrace Serial 2
Software Includes PowerView software, debug license and 1 year maintenance
Multicore support Yes, for same and other architectures via optional licenses
PC connection USB 3 and Gigabit Ethernet
Debug Port 1
Serial trace lanes Up to 8 (Just 6 with shown flex cable)
Recording speed 12.5 Gbit/s per lane @ 8 lanes
Streaming 400 Mbyte/s
Trace Memory 8 GByte
Signal probing via optional Mixed-Signal Probe
Serial Trace with Aurora 2 probe for highest speeds
Debug Hardware Lauterbach PowerDebug X50 with debug probe
Trace Hardware PowerTrace Serial 2 with Aurora 2 trace probe
Software Includes PowerView software, debug license and 1 year maintenance
Multicore support Yes, for same and other architectures via optional licenses
PC connection USB 3 and Gigabit Ethernet
Debug Port 1
Serial trace lanes up to 8
Recording speed 22.5 Gbit/s per lane @ 4 lanes, 12.5 Gbit/s per lane @ 8 lanes
Streaming 400 Mbyte/s
Trace Memory 8 GByte
Signal probing via optional Mixed-Signal Probe
Debugging via 3rd party API
Supported High-Level APIs MCD, GDB, CADI, IRIS, GDI, ARCINT (depends on CPU architecture)
Supported Low-Level APIs XCP, GTL, CSWP, SPP, VPI, DCI.DbC, Tessent/USOC (depends on CPU architecture)
Content Includes PowerView software, front-end license and 1 year maintenance
Licenses Options Backend-license for low-level APIs, Trace decoder license
Instruction Set Simulator
Simulator Simulates the instruction set of an architecture family (including its subfamilies)
Extendable Models of memory mapped peripheral can be connected
Automated testing The included license allows automated tests with the simulator.
Content Includes PowerView software, simulator license and 1 year maintenance
Debugging via 3rd party API
Supported High-Level APIs MCD, GDB, CADI, IRIS, GDI, ARCINT (depends on CPU architecture)
Supported Low-Level APIs XCP, GTL, CSWP, SPP, VPI, DCI.DbC, Tessent/USOC (depends on CPU architecture)
Content Includes PowerView software, front-end license and 1 year maintenance
Licenses Options Backend-license for low-level APIs, Trace decoder license